Armored Saint, live on Headbanger's Ball in Minneapolis, 1987, full show
Setlist:
March Of The Saint
Underdogs
Human Vulture
Chemical Euphoria
Isolation
Can U Deliver
Madhouse

OCT, 20, 1987 Armored Saint Setlist at First Avenue, Minneapolis, MN, USA Tour: Hell On Wheels Tourt Setlist March of the Saint 0:20 Underdogs 3:29 (Last known live performance) Human Vulture 7:22 Chemical Euphoria 12:11 Isolation 16:35 (Last known live performance) Can U Deliver 22:11 Mad House 26:30
